summaryrefslogtreecommitdiff
path: root/sandbox/code-block-directive/docs/myfunction.py.tex
diff options
context:
space:
mode:
Diffstat (limited to 'sandbox/code-block-directive/docs/myfunction.py.tex')
-rw-r--r--sandbox/code-block-directive/docs/myfunction.py.tex41
1 files changed, 24 insertions, 17 deletions
diff --git a/sandbox/code-block-directive/docs/myfunction.py.tex b/sandbox/code-block-directive/docs/myfunction.py.tex
index d8c934c7a..689a02703 100644
--- a/sandbox/code-block-directive/docs/myfunction.py.tex
+++ b/sandbox/code-block-directive/docs/myfunction.py.tex
@@ -1,20 +1,20 @@
-\documentclass[10pt,a4paper,english]{article}
+\documentclass[10pt,a4paper,english]{scrartcl}
\usepackage{babel}
-\usepackage{ae}
-\usepackage{aeguill}
+\usepackage[T1]{fontenc}
\usepackage{shortvrb}
-\usepackage[latin1]{inputenc}
+\usepackage{ucs}
+\usepackage[utf8x]{inputenc}
\usepackage{tabularx}
\usepackage{longtable}
+\usepackage{booktabs}
\setlength{\extrarowheight}{2pt}
\usepackage{amsmath}
\usepackage{graphicx}
\usepackage{color}
\usepackage{multirow}
\usepackage{ifthen}
-\usepackage[colorlinks=true,linkcolor=blue,urlcolor=blue]{hyperref}
-\usepackage[DIV12]{typearea}
-%% generator Docutils: http://docutils.sourceforge.net/
+\typearea{12}
+% generated by Docutils <http://docutils.sourceforge.net/>
\newlength{\admonitionwidth}
\setlength{\admonitionwidth}{0.9\textwidth}
\newlength{\docinfowidth}
@@ -55,6 +55,20 @@
\newcommand{\rubric}[1]{\subsection*{~\hfill {\it #1} \hfill ~}}
\newcommand{\titlereference}[1]{\textsl{#1}}
% end of "some commands"
+% user specified packages and stylesheets:
+\usepackage{cmlgc}
+\ifthenelse{\isundefined{\hypersetup}}{
+\usepackage[colorlinks=true,linkcolor=blue,urlcolor=blue]{hyperref}
+}{}
+% Custom roles:
+% \DUrole{NAME}{content} calls \docutilsroleNAME if it exists
+\providecommand{\DUrole}[2]{%
+ \ifcsname docutilsrole#1\endcsname%
+ \csname docutilsrole#1\endcsname{#2}%
+ \else%
+ #2%
+ \fi%
+}
\title{}
\author{}
\date{}
@@ -68,17 +82,10 @@ This is a test of the new code-block directive:
%
% rst2html-highlight --stylesheet=pygments-default.css --link-stylesheet
\begin{quote}{\ttfamily \raggedright \noindent
-\docutilsroleNone{def}~\docutilsroleNone{my{\_}function}\docutilsroleNone{():}~\\
-~~~~\docutilsroleNone{"just~a~test"}~\\
-~~~~\docutilsroleNone{print}~\docutilsroleNone{8}\docutilsroleNone{/}\docutilsroleNone{2}~\\
+\DUrole{k}{def}~\DUrole{nf}{my{\_}function}\DUrole{p}{():}~\\
+~~~~\DUrole{s}{"just~a~test"}~\\
+~~~~\DUrole{k}{print}~\DUrole{mf}{8}\DUrole{o}{/}\DUrole{mf}{2}~\\
}\end{quote}
-\begin{center}\small
-
-Generated on: 2007-06-05.
-
-
-\end{center}
-
\end{document}